ORAL ORDER
Petitioners are street vendors operating in several areas in Bangalore. At the instance of residents and few shop owners who are legitimately operating businesses from pucca buildings, action is initiated by the respondent authorities to evict the street vendors. Aggrieved by the same, the present petition is filed.
2. Admittedly, the street vendors do not have a right to infringe upon the rights of the business persons operating from pucca buildings after obtaining all the necessary permissions. They also do not have a right to cause nuisance to residents in front of whose house the street vendors tend to operate. However, taking into consideration the poor economic background of the street vendors, the State has enacted the Street Vendors (Protection of Livelihood and Regulation of Street Vending) Act , 2014.
3. The counsel appearing for Bruhat Bengaluru Mahanagara Palike (BBMP) and the State together submittaking into consideration all the aforementioned factors, action would be initiated to evict the street vendors or rehabilitate them in the manner known to law. They further submit all the affected parties will be heard in accordance with law before taking appropriate action.
4. The writ petitions stand disposed of in terms of the submission made by the learned counsel for BBMP and the State.
Pending interlocutory applications, if any, stand disposed of.
